System.Tether.Manager.TTetheringProfile.GetConnectionTo
Delphi
function GetConnectionTo(const AProfile: TTetheringProfileInfo; const AProtocolType: TTetheringProtocolType = '';
const AnAdapterType: TTetheringAdapterType = ''; Connect: Boolean = True): TTetheringConnection; virtual;
C++
virtual TTetheringConnection* __fastcall GetConnectionTo(const TTetheringProfileInfo &AProfile, const TTetheringProtocolType AProtocolType = System::UnicodeString(), const TTetheringAdapterType AnAdapterType = System::UnicodeString(), bool Connect = true);
プロパティ
| 種類 | 可視性 | ソース | ユニット | 親 |
|---|---|---|---|---|
| function | protected | System.Tether.Manager.pas System.Tether.Manager.hpp |
System.Tether.Manager | TTetheringProfile |
説明
指定されたリモート プロファイルにアクセスするための接続を返します。
AProtocolType と AnAdapterType を使って、返される接続のプロトコルとアダプタの種類を指定します。この 2 つのパラメータはセットで使用しなければなりません。つまり、一方に空でない値を指定した場合には、もう一方にも空でない値を指定しなければなりません。
Connect を使って、GetConnectionTo で返される接続のプロトコルを接続済みにしたいか(True)したくないか(False)を指定します。
例外
GetConnectionTo では、次の例外が発生する可能性があります。
| 例外 | メッセージ | シナリオ |
|---|---|---|
|
<リモート プロファイル> への使用可能な接続がありません |
||
|
<リモート プロファイル> に接続するためのプロトコルとアダプタを追加する必要があります |
| |
|
プロファイル <リモート プロファイル> への接続を取得できません |
| |
|
プロファイル <リモート プロファイル> に接続できません |